With negotiations for a huge domestic tear-up between Carl Frampton and Scott Quigg having stalled, the Quigg camp has announced the name of their next opponent.

The Bury fighter will be headlining a promotion at the Manchester Arena on July 18th where Scott will take on somebody who Frampton has beaten not once but twice when he takes on Kiko Martinez.

After recovering from his hand injury Quigg will be looking to remain active and us looking to get back into the ring, talking about a fight with Kiko Martinez the Bury fighter has remarked,

‘I was very busy and the break has done me good – I am refreshed.

‘We know what Kiko brings, he’s been in everyone’s backyard and this is the toughest fight of my career – but there’s one thing I know, I will beat him.

‘This is a dangerous fight and those are the ones I want. It’s the type of fight that you get out of bed for your morning runs for – the fear of losing that World title makes me work even harder.’


What the punters will be looking at is whether Quigg can do a better job on Martinez than Frampton did, we can but wait and see.
